L-012 sodium salt is a luminol-based chemiluminescent probe widely used for the sensitive detection of reactive oxygen and nitrogen species (ROS and RNS) in biological systems. It is particularly effective in monitoring NADPH oxidase (Nox)-derived superoxide production, providing high signal intensity and low background interference.
Compared with conventional luminol, L-012 offers enhanced chemiluminescence sensitivity and stability, enabling real-time detection of oxidative and nitrosative stress in cells, tissues, and *in vivo* models. It is a valuable tool for studying redox signaling, inflammation, and oxidative stress–related pathophysiology.
